Story Structure — 5 Plot Phases

A Marriage Without Desire

Erminia marries Antonio, a handsome but brutish butcher, under family pressure. Their disastrous wedding night quickly becomes a major marital confrontation.

Flight To Another World

After the fight, Erminia leaves town and stays with her older sister Angela. Angela's sexually liberated lifestyle introduces Erminia to a very different social environment.

The Awakening

Erminia becomes involved with Angela's jaded swinger friends. Through this circle, she begins a significant sexual and personal awakening.

Antonio's Consolations

Antonio responds to the marital rupture by picking up prostitutes. He then begins an affair with a wealthy widow neighbor.

Desire In The Villa

Antonio and the Widow Neighbor continue their affair inside the mother-in-law's villa. The affair changes the psychological and sexual dynamics surrounding the failed marriage.

Story Breakdown

A decadent countess, middle-aged but still attractive, forces her young and timid daughter to marry a rich butcher. But the couple’s sexual relation is troubled, because the girl has her fair share of inhibitions. So she abandons her house and seeks refuge at her sister’s place. During her absence, her husband finds consolation in his mother in law’s arms.
